Fashionable Styles of Eternity Rings for Women
When selecting an eternity ring, many women discover they're drawn to the variety of styles available. Traditional full eternity rings feature a seamless band of gemstones, representing everlasting love. Half eternity rings, in contrast, showcase stones only on the front, delivering a moderately more subtle elegance. Some women select channel-set eternity rings, where stones are securely embedded in a metal channel, providing a sleek and sophisticated look. Retro-inspired designs often feature detailed detailing and milgrain work, evoking a sense of timeless charm. Furthermore, there are exceptional styles that combine different shapes, such as oval or baguette cut stones, facilitating individual expression. As trends consistently evolve, stackable eternity rings also gain popularity, allowing women to mix and match styles for a customized appearance. Each style provides a unique way to celebrate love and commitment, making the selection process both captivating and meaningful.

Durability and Hardness
Hardness and durability are crucial elements to consider when selecting a gemstone for an eternity ring. An eternity ring represents eternal love, making it vital for the selected gemstone to withstand everyday use. Diamonds, known for their exceptional hardness on the Mohs scale, are a favored option due to their brilliance and durability. Additional resilient choices include sapphires and rubies, both of which also exhibit significant hardness and can be found in multiple colors. Conversely, softer stones like opals or pearls, while beautiful, may not be ideal for daily use due to their vulnerability to scratches and damage. In the end, selecting a durable gemstone guarantees that the ring remains a enduring symbol of love and commitment.

Maintaining Your Eternity Ring
Looking after an eternity ring is important to keeping its elegance and integrity, as consistent maintenance can stop damage and keep the stones shining. To guarantee longevity, it is recommended to clean the ring periodically using a delicate soap and warm water solution. A soft toothbrush can assist in remove any dirt or grime that collects in the settings.
In addition, it is crucial to store the eternity ring properly, ideally in a cushioned jewelry box or pouch, to avoid scratches or other damage when not being worn. Routine inspections by a professional jeweler can also identify any loose stones or wear on the band, enabling timely repairs.
Keep away from exposing the ring to aggressive chemicals, like household cleaners or chlorine, which may dull its sparkle. By observing these care guidelines, owners can preserve the ring's elegance and confirm it remains a lasting symbol of affection and devotion.

Finding the Right Fit for Your Eternity Ring
What's the best way to guarantee the perfect fit for an eternity ring? The process begins with precise measurement of the finger. Jewelers generally recommend measuring the finger at the end of the day when it is least swollen. Using a ring sizer or a piece of string can provide a initial measurement, but visiting a professional jeweler provides precision.
Moreover, it is important to take into account the width of the band. Broader bands might feel snugger compared to thinner ones, so size modifications might be required. Moreover, the choice of metal can affect fit, as certain metals, for example platinum, may feel different versus gold or silver.
Lastly, understanding personal comfort is vital; a comfortable fit is perfect, permitting slight movement without sliding off. By combining these approaches, one can with confidence find an eternity ring that embodies everlasting love while ensuring lasting comfort.

Could Eternity Rings to Be Resized Should the Need Arise?
Yes, eternity rings are able to be resized; however, the process may be complex due to their continuous design. It is recommended to seek advice from a professional jeweler to guarantee the integrity and aesthetics of the ring are maintained.
